    Abstract: A device is configured to control display of a live broadcast of an interactive multi-user activity session in a network application. The device receives a user request for triggering an interactive live broadcast in the network application and obtains a live broadcast page for interaction in the network application from a server end. The computing device then causes display of the live broadcast page on a display located at a public broadcast location. The interaction in the network application is to be performed among users corresponding to user terminals that are located in proximity to the public broadcast location. The computing device obtains, in real time by using a persistent connection established to the server end, an update message corresponding to a dynamic change in user data in the interaction in the network application. The computing device updates display of the live broadcast page according to the update message.

    Abstract: Disclosed are methods of mobilizing hematopoietic cells in a subject by administering to the subject a combination of Flt3 ligand (FLT3L) and a cell adhesion inhibitor. Also disclosed are methods of mobilizing hematopoietic cells in a cell culture population by contacting the cell culture population with Flt3 ligand. Mobilized hematopoietic cells can subsequently be harvested and used for hematopoietic cell transplantation. Further disclosed are compositions comprising a FLT3L, compositions comprising FLT3L and a cell adhesion inhibitor, and composition comprising FLT3L and Plerixafor.

    Abstract: A system and a method for driving light emitters of a liquid crystal display (LCD) backlight module is disclosed. The system drives the light emitters by supplying a constant current and a pulse width modulated current to an individual light emitter, the pulse width modulated current being determined in accordance with an optical output of the light emitter. Accordingly, the system can provide a desired amount of current to the light emitters, and individually control the optical output of the light emitters.
